Adds 9 historical camos from World War 2 to your game.
Other Mods that can be seen in the preview pictures are listed below.

In order of preview pictures:

Splittertarn (splinter pattern): First introduced in 1931 by the German army of the Weimar republic to be used on Ponchos, it was widely used in the German armed forces in WW2 and afterwards until 1960.
Primary Colour: 2 Secondary Colour: 72

Eichenlaubtarn (oak leaf pattern): Introduced by the Waffen-SS in 1942, this is an early example of Flecktarn patterns, some of which are still in use today.
PC: 81 SC: 9

Sumpftarn (marsh pattern): Variation of the Splittertarn with more blurry edges and different colours for marsh environments.
PC: 2 SC: 22

Telo Mimetico: Meaning "Camouflage Cloth" in italian, it was introduced in 1929 for Ponchos and such and later adapted as the first pattern to be used on military clothing in history. Used by Italian and German troops in WW2 and by Italian troops until the early 1990s.
PC: 26 SC: 44

Frog Skin: Introduced in 1942 by the United States Marines Corps for their Pacific Campaign, being the first camo pattern to be used by the United States Armed Forces.
PC: 28 SC: 22

Erbsentarn (Peas Pattern aka "Dot 44"): Introduced by the German Waffen-SS in 1944, it was meant to replace both current field and working uniforms. Already closely resembles modern Flecktarn-variants.
PC: 0 SC: 29

Palmenmuster (Palm tree pattern): Introduced by the Waffen-SS in 1943, it saw extensive use on the Eastern Front in the following years.
PC: 29 SC: 36

Amoeba: Originally named MKK, it was the first mass-produced pattern in the soviet union and was issued to engineers, snipers, reconaissance troops and such.
PC: 3 SC: 22

Leaf Pattern: Its original name being Summer camouflage, it was nicknamed leaf pattern for obvious reasons. Issued in 1941 to the troops of the soviet union, it continued being used until the 1960s.
PC: 2 SC: 72

All patterns are fully customizable, like the vanilla patterns.
